Multichannel AI Sales Closer for recruitment agencies. A multi-tenant SaaS platform. Replies to inbound leads in 30 seconds across Telegram, WhatsApp, and a web widget — walks a candidate from "just curious" to a submitted application, and hands hot leads off to a recruiter. Driven by sales methodologies (SPIN, NEPQ, AIDA) — not a FAQ bot.
Phase 1 ICP: recruitment agencies in RU/CIS/MENA, Telegram-first, ARPU $99–199/mo. [Phase 2: real estate. Phase 3: horizontal.]
How it works: a business signs up → connects its own Telegram bot
(auto-setWebhook in 60s) → configures its own OpenAI / Anthropic key
(BYOK) → uploads documents into the KB → the AI replies and drives the
funnel. An operator can take over any conversation at any time from the
inbox.
Each customer is an independent tenant with its own channels, LLM
config, knowledge base, and data isolation enforced at the Postgres RLS
level.

bun run test # bun test across the whole monorepo (700+ tests)Each customer is a tenant row with a unique slug. All domain data is
scoped by tenant_id:
tenants ─┬─ admins (multi-admin per tenant + invite flow) ─ admin_invites
├─ channels (telegram_bot / telegram_userbot / whatsapp / web)
├─ contacts ─ channel_identities (channel-agnostic person ↔ messenger)
├─ conversations ─ messages
├─ leads ─ lead_events ─ lead_notes
├─ kb_documents ─ kb_chunks (per-tenant RAG)
├─ styles, experiments, skills, ...
├─ outbound_queue (SKIP LOCKED)
├─ tenant_secrets (AES-256-GCM encrypted)
├─ llm_provider_configs (per-purpose: chat | embed | vision | judge)
└─ audit_log
FORCE ROW LEVEL SECURITY on 34 tenant-scoped tables with the policy:
USING (tenant_id = current_setting('app.tenant_id', true)::int)
WITH CHECK (tenant_id = current_setting('app.tenant_id', true)::int)All production code paths wrap repo calls in withTenant(db, tenantId, fn)
— it opens a transaction and runs SET LOCAL app.tenant_id = X.
Production critical: apps/api / apps/worker MUST connect under a
NOSUPERUSER NOBYPASSRLS Postgres role. Otherwise RLS is bypassed. On
boot both processes log info "RLS enforced" or warn "RLS not enforced"
with a remediation hint.
Validated in packages/storage/src/rls.integration.test.ts (8 tests) and
apps/api/src/multi-tenant.integration.test.ts (10 E2E tests).

Detailed steps:
1. Webhook handler receives the HTTP POST (apps/api)
2. Validate signature → 401 if bad
3. Lookup tenant + channel via ChannelRegistry (in-memory)
4. Rate-limit check per tenant (60/min, 600/hour default) → 429 if over
5. adapter.pushUpdate(payload) → adapter inbox
6. ┌─ Phase 1 (tx1, withTenant): persist inside Postgres ──────┐
│ - resolveContact (lookup or create Contact + ChannelIdentity)
│ - resolveConversation (per channel)
│ - persist Message (unique dedup by external_message_id)
│ - vertical-template extractFields hook
│ - stageClassifier (~300ms LLM) → applyClassifiedStage
│ - memoryExtractor (~500ms LLM) → mergeAttributes
└────────────────────────────────────────────────────────────┘
7. Phase 2 (NOT in tx): reply.generate(...) — ~1-2s LLM. Pool connection
released.
8. Phase 3 (tx2, withTenant): enqueue OutboundEnvelope[] into outbound_queue.
9. Phase 4 (async, NOT in tx): if inbound has photo parts and tenant has a
`vision` LLM configured → classifyPhoto() → if "passport" →
extractPassportIdentity() → merge into contact.attributes_json.
Fire-and-forget; never blocks the webhook response.
10. Webhook → 200 ack (< 100ms typical).
11. apps/worker (TG-bot / WA) or apps/api (web / TG userbot) drain
outbound_queue via SKIP LOCKED → adapter.send → mark sent.

bun test --coverageThe @chatman-media/* packages in packages/* are published to npm via
semantic-release on every push to
main. Versioning is independent per package and derived from
Conventional Commits scoped to each
package's directory (semantic-release-monorepo).
- A
feat:commit touchingpackages/kbcuts aminorfor@chatman-media/kb. - A
fix:cuts apatch;feat!:/BREAKING CHANGE:cuts amajor. - Each release tags
@chatman-media/<pkg>-vX.Y.Z, updates the packageCHANGELOG.md, publishes to npm, and creates a GitHub Release. - Workspace (
workspace:*) dependencies are resolved to concrete versions at publish time viabun publish.
CI publishes packages in dependency order so interdependent packages always
resolve. Requires an NPM_TOKEN repository secret with publish rights to the
@chatman-media scope.
